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Crescent City to Manteca is to drive which costs $75 - $110 and takes 7h 51m.
The fastest way to get from Crescent City to Manteca is to fly and train which takes 5h 7m and costs $220 - $310.
No, there is no direct bus from Crescent City to Manteca. However, there are services departing from Crescent City Cultural Center/CoC and arriving at Main & Louise Southbound via Grants Pass, Sacramento Bus Station and Downtown Transit Center Weber Avenue.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 14h 36m.
The distance between Crescent City and Manteca is 384 miles. The road distance is 416.5 miles.
The best way to get from Crescent City to Manteca without a car is to bus which takes 14h 36m and costs $75 - $180.
It takes approximately 5h 7m to get from Crescent City to Manteca, including transfers.
Crescent City to Manteca bus services, operated by Amtrak Thruway, depart from Crescent City Cultural Center/CoC station.
Crescent City to Manteca bus services, operated by Amtrak Thruway, arrive at Newman United Methodist - Grants Pass station.
Yes, the driving distance between Crescent City to Manteca is 416 miles. It takes approximately 7h 51m to drive from Crescent City to Manteca.
